Output e8003b66dc5ec4d330c176a51188b69dcd927f2d5551b4aa47da9ba8ffcf67de:1

value
994396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a95fc3856d0167da55749c5a2ef50d322f75b3b OP_EQUAL
address
39wzQxwVayFYoQCz8XvrWF545iZLichkVw
transaction
e8003b66dc5ec4d330c176a51188b69dcd927f2d5551b4aa47da9ba8ffcf67de
confirmations
367331
spent
true